Chesapeake Industries stock certificate specimen
Uncommon piece circa 1987 is a printers sample from the American Banknote Company. Vignette includes the company logo representing their forestry interests. Clean and crisp example circa 1987.
Chesapeake made wood doors and millwork products through multiple subsidiaries including Southern Door. A statement said the company intends to sell "substantially all of the assets of its operating subsidiaries" by March 31, 1992 and has placed three subsidiaries--Anderco Inc. in Fullerton and Continental Door Inc. and Forest Products Manufacturing Co., both in Rocklin near Sacramento--into Chapter 11 bankruptcy proceedings, protecting the assets from creditor claims.
